Learn GUI application development from the ground up by building simple projects that teach the fundamentals of using PyQt6. This 2nd edition includes updated code, programs, and new chapters to get you started using the newest version. Taking a practical approach, each chapter will gradually teach more advanced and diverse concepts to aid you in designing and customizing interesting and professional applications.
You'll start by learning important concepts related to GUI development, and then jump right into building different and exciting projects in every chapter. Along the way, you’ll discover new widgets, layouts, and other concepts that will help you to build better UIs. You'll also construct more elaborate GUIs, covering topics that include storing data using the clipboard, graphics and animation, support for SQL databases, multithreading applications, and building modern-looking interfaces.
Using this knowledge, you’ll be able to build a photo editor, games, a text editor, a working web browser, and an assortment of other GUIs. In the end, this book will guide you through the process of creating UIs to help you bring your own ideas to life. Find out what you need to begin making your own applications with PyQt!

Table of Contents
Chapter 1: Getting Started with PyQt
Chapter 2: Building a Simple GUI
Chapter 3: Adding More Functionality with Widgets
Chapter 4: Learning About Layout Management
Chapter 5: Menus, Toolbars, and More
Chapter 6: Styling Your GUls
Chapter 7: Handling Events in PyQt
Chapter 8: Creating GUls with Qt Designer
Chapter 9: Working with the Clipboard
Chapter 10: Presenting Data in PyQt
Chapter 11: Graphics and Animation in PyQt
Chapter 12: Creating Custom Widgets
Chapter 13: Working with Qt Quick
Chapter 14: Introduction to Handling Databases
Chapter 15: Managing Threads
Chapter 16: Extra Projects
Appendix: Reference Guide for PyQt6
Joshua Willman is a software engineer with more than 12 years of experience developing applications in mainly Python and C++. His career has allowed him to participate in many different fields, from robotics, machine learning, and computer vision, to UI development, game development, and more. His first experience with PyQt was building an interface for simplifying the labeling process of datasets for machine learning. Ever since then, he’s been hooked!
In recent years, his passion for programming and all things visual has allowed him to participate in numerous projects. These include designing educational courses for mobile robotics and computer vision using Arduino and Raspberry Pi, building GUI applications, and working as a solo indie game developer. He currently works as a robotics engineer, a technical writer, and a content creator (learning web development in his spare time in order to build his own platform, redhuli.io).
